Demographic scientists expect decrease in birth rate and increase in divorces in Bashkiria

In the near future, a sharp growth in the birth rate is not expected.
On the contrary, the number of births will decrease; the number of divorces will increase; there will be more civil marriages. The associate professor of BAGSU, Ph.D. in Economics Yana Skryabina stated this at an online conference organized by the Bashinform News Agency.
Renata Komleva, junior research scientist of the Institute for Strategic Studies confirms the words of her colleague.
Young families do not seek to have children even though the state interested in raising the birth rate provides payment of the child benefits.
According to Renata, the payment of maternity capital played a certain role in increasing the birth rate, but there are also some nuances in the financial stimulation of family growth.
"The number of births is concentrated on a certain period of time, falling on the time of this policy is in force. The birth calendar is swinging - a woman simply implements her plans for the birth of children a little earlier, and then the number of children decreases," Komleva said.
For a steady increase in the birth rate, not only financial support is necessary, but also the improvement of the healthcare system, preschool education, and children's infrastructure.
In her opinion, France is an example here, which shows steady growth in the birth rate relative to other countries.
